Similar problem was found on 74 360CB caused by corrosion at the spark plug end of the coil wire (both sides). The Coil is molded to the spark plug wire, but the spark plug connector seems to be just screwed into the end of the wire. When un-screwed, the connection had a green tint = corrosion. Once the corrosion problem started, I´ve had to re-terminate the spark plug connection to the coil wire every couple years. (So I´m probably not making this connection properly.) Tom
